This section describes how to set up your system to send and receive traps. And we hope you see trapstation as a compelling alternative to unsupported scripts, or in house development. Devices that typically support snmp include cable modems, routers, switches, servers, workstations, printers, and more. So i receive a trap for something like interface down trapoid 1.
Computers can receive the snmp alerts even if they do not have commserve software installed. It is necessary that udp packets can make it from the agent to. A good network fault monitoring system should be able to support snmp traps and provide meaningful information to the operators. But the linkdown that i received from me1200 devices has the below varbinds 1. In the case of standard mibs, cisco has enhanced some notifications with additional varbinds that further clarify the cause of the notification. This way the user should add the varbinds to its own pbuf stream and pass that stream to. Compiling snmp mibs technical documentation support. Select the multivarbind menu item from the view menu to view the multi varbind panel. For instructions about sending all varbinds, see sending all snmp trap varbinds. Varbinds are alert data incorporated into snmp traps, that are sent to the snmp manager. Send a series of snmp getnext requests using the following options. Hello, is it possible to create snmp trap messages with multiple varbinds.
Select v1v2trapforwardingtable or v3trapforwardingtable from the traptables module of agentconfiguration group. The tokens will be included in the body of the alert notification message. In version 9 of the psax system software, the varbind. The list of varbinds associated with a notification is included in the notification definition in the mib. Cisco nexus 7000 series nxos mib quick reference cisco. In simple terms, the snmp device has reloaded the software.
Jun 22, 2018 for instructions about sending all varbinds, see sending all snmp trap varbinds. Hi, im currently using lwip git master commit 0737cfb and investigating to update to the latest master. Apply an snmp operation errorindication, errorstatus, errorindex, varbinds cmd self. Opmanager does exactly that by providing support for basic snmp traps outofthebox. My issue is that whenever i set a value for an oid i end up with an illegal value. The snmp agent implementation, briefly described, is as follows. Snmp alert notifications can be customized by adding alert token arguments to the alert configuration. Snmp uses the user datagram protocol udp to transfer messages. Most of these have free versions or trials for you to test our and others require you to pay upfront before testing. An agent is a software module that translates device information into an snmp compatible format in order to make the device information available for monitoring with snmp. Consider the mib a way of decoding what the agent is telling you. For more information on the varbinds associated with the trap, see table 3. The cisco nxos software uses aes as one of the privacy protocols for snmp message encryption and conforms with rfc 3826.
Listening for snmp traps is a safe method to ensure that your device is operating properly. Ena identifies whether the trap that is being generated is based on an event or incident, and then selects the relevant event or incident list of varbinds. Nov 25, 2015 this python tutorial will teach you how to query the dell poweredge temperature sensors via snmp. But the asl script is receiving only the first 20 varbinds from trap receiver. If the management station creates an snmp user in the usmusertable, the corresponding cli user is created without any password login is disabled and will have the networkoperator role. Trap is a generic term that refers to a software packet containing data such as system messages, stored in a predefined data structure for interpretation and use by enterprise monitor software. Verify device credentials and snmp response speed from device. Hi, i do not understand what does it mean this trap. In this case the information is sent from a snmp enabled device and is collected or trapped by zabbix. Apr 09, 2015 snmp stands for simple network management protocol. Setting up alerts and notifications snmp traps documentation. By selecting the respective table and clicking snmp table icon, mib browser opens up a wizard wherein entries can be added to the traptables. Snmp requires only a couple of basic components to work. In most examples approximate analogues of well known netsnmp snmp tools command line options are shown.
Browse and upload the mib file from the appropriate location where the mib file is stored. It will normally process one request at a time, and will finish with one before looking at the next. It is necessary that udp packets can make it from the agent to the manager for monitoring to be successful. They provide the bulk of processing and memory resources. It is a standard way of monitoring hardware and software from nearly any manufacturer, from juniper, to cisco, to microsoft, unix, and everything in between. There are some exceptions, but thats the usual mode of operation so the second pdu to arrive wont even be looked at until its finished processing the first. Select snmp mib compiler in the operations section of the admin page. Usually traps are sent upon some condition change and the agent connects to the server on port 162 as opposed to port 161 on the agent side that is used for queries. Many devices use snmp to report their health and operations. Existing snmp users continue to retain the auth and priv passphrases without any changes.
Most network devices nowadays are capable of sending out snmp traps when a fault occurs. A commserve computer can send snmp alerts to multiple computers. The net snmp agent is essentially a singleminded beast. Sections in this guide follow mib groups and provide explanations and definitions for the terms used to define mib objects. Without the mib, the snmp client would receive varbinds oids, data type, data value but. Alternatively, you can get the namevalue pairs by requesting. The simple network management protocol is part of the internet protocol suite as an application layer layer 7 protocol of the osi model. Running the net snmp agent or trap receiver as a service on windows 95 or windows 98 is not supported. The snmp mib is a keyvalue store, and the varbind is the data structure representing the keyvalue pair. Removed the dependency between the number of varbinds that a defined trap could receive and the number of fields value used for event tags.
In this, the most commonly used snmp messages are the snmp traps. Receiving snmp traps is the opposite to querying snmp enabled devices. Free mib browser tool is smart desktop dashboard software that helps. The mib file you have uploaded is displayed in the pending node of the mib tree.
Opennms cannot decode snmp trap varbinds of type bits. How robot console supports snmp traps customer portal. Trap reception will be disabled when the snmp channel is a member of a virtual network. The code will performs snmp get operation for a sysdescr. What is placed into the varbinds is defined in the mib. Cisco mds 9000 family nxos system management configuration. A library which could leverage the power and speed of the net snmp project, while being portable purepython and not being tied to any particular version of net snmp. Restricting switch access you can restrict access to a cisco mds 9000 family switch using ip access control.
Snmp is a popular tcpip network management standard, supported by most unixbased and ntbased enterprise management tools. Youve converted your mibs to the opennms xml format, but still you get events like this shown in the first screenshot. This module is installed using node package manager npm. In writing this library, i set out to find a middle ground. If you want to add custom varbinds to these snmp traps, please contact entuity professional services. This python tutorial will teach you how to query the dell poweredge temperature sensors via snmp. The header in the preceding example is the management information base mib. I accomplished this by making a library that calls the net snmp binaries as subprocesses. Also note that there is a higherlevel interface to the notification receiver application. An snmp agentthe software component within the managed device that maintains the data for the device and reports these data, as needed, to managing systems.
This is basically how most devices in a network communicate. I try to do but the traps always only has 2 varbinds. Check the services panel to be sure no other snmp program conflicts. Enjoy support for snmp v3 encryptionsecurity, trap modification, log searchreplay, a browser interface, and more. Adding masks that filter on varbinds is documented on the snmp trap configuration page. Cisco nxos adds additional varbinds specific to cisco systems in addition to. Now i need an asl script to parse more information to enrich notification information. This patch shows, albeit a bit hacky, how varbinds can be added to traps. I need to print the key status, based on varbinds, it is connected if integer1, disconnected if integer2 i have read that, varbinds is a tuple of managed objects and each managed object is a pair of object name and object value. How do i forward snmp traps to third party trap receivers. This data is encrypted and is contained in a typical keyvalue pair. Hello, im configuring smarts to receive snmp traps from oracle cloud control. Cisco nexus 5000 series nxos software configuration guide.
This is a purepython, open source and free implementation of v1v2cv3 snmp engine distributed under 2clause bsd license the pysnmp project was initially sponsored by a psf grant. It is intended primarily to enable the construction of a simple, generalpurpose agent as an alternative to net snmp. The following is an example of an snmp trap where all varbinds are. Snmp traps with more than 20 varbinds dell community. To meet the serialization requirements, the snmp driver now serializes tag processing and device discovery. The information in table 1 can be found in the g3avayamib. Once openmanage software is installed on a dell server, a ton of information is made available via snmp including chassis temperature fans speed chassis intrusion switch hard drive health power supply status, voltages, and consumption prerequisites 1. This reference guide provides information about simple network management protocol snmp management information base mib which are released with the current version of dell idrac and chassis management controller. Im using the snmp agent, including sending specific snmp traps with varbinds. The varbinds are filled by the agent when it sends a response or a trap. I am trying to automate a backup solution for the cisco rfgw1 devices that we currently have in our network using snmp from a python script. This way the user should add the varbinds to its own pbuf stream and pass that stream to the trap sending function.
Snmp reference guide for avaya communication manager. They often use snmp traps to notify failures but the best case is when they embed a true snmp agent and a documented mib which specifies the meaning of each snmp oid. A quick recap on the difference between traps and informs. Snmp monitoring fuhrende snmp monitoring software solarwinds. Use the snmptargetmib to obtain more information on trap destinations and inform requests.
Below youll find a list of the top tools and software we recommend for those looking for a monitoring and management solution for your network and devices. The simple network management protocol snmp has two strikes against it right from the outset. Install the snmp enabler software on the commserve computer. A trap is a snmp message sent from one application to another which is typically on a.
The send snmp trap action includes a default list of varbinds. Snmp originated in the 1980s at the time when organizational networks were growing in both size and complexity. Unable to collect details neighbor device using cisco discovery protocol. A network management system runs monitoring applications. The simple network management protocol snmp is an applicationlayer protocol for exchanging management information between network devices. Dell openmanage snmp reference guide for idrac and. Security configuring snmp cisco mds 9000 nxos and san. A benefit of using traps for reporting alarms is that they trigger. The last two digits of the trap oid indicate products and the software. An snmp managerthe system used to control and monitor the activities of network devices using snmp. Simple network management protocol snmp is an internet standard protocol for collecting and organizing information about managed devices on ip networks and for modifying that information to change device behavior. Snmp traps are alerts generated by agents on a managed device. It also describes the traps that you can use to receive change notification for logical domains domains, as well as other traps that you can use. Without the mib, the snmp client would receive varbinds oids, data type, data value but you may not know what the value represents.
1097 711 796 614 230 656 1346 1184 290 1597 474 1351 1342 253 1477 501 407 1035 566 1383 956 307 217 348 1431 207 470 750 220 306 1127 1169 1442 1309 743 1380 1335 811 1067 639 612